Hauksgrund
Hauksgrund is a locality in Ludwigsau, Hersfeld-Rotenburg, Hesse. Hauksgrund is situated nearby to the hamlet Biedebach, as well as near the village Untergeis.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Gittersdorf and Reckerode.

Bad Hersfeld
Photo: Jojoo64,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Bad Hersfeld is a town in North Hesse that Hersfeld is known across Germany for the Bad Hersfelder Festspiele. The festival has taken place each year since 1951 at the ruins of a monastery which are said to be Europe's biggest Romanesque church ruin.
